|  | Cadillac Owners Enthusiast Cadillac(s): '04 SRX V8 AWD; '06 Jeep Commander Ltd. Hemi AWD | | Join Date: Mar 2004 Location: South Bend, IN Age: 63 | | | Re: SRX Trailer Hitch Nothing was MISSING. Caddy offers a "Trailering Equipment" option when ordering. (read right from my window sticker). It only includes HD Cooling and wiring. Price $250 List
You must order from your dealer's parts dept. the Hitch kit #: 12498654 at $357.14 List plus installation, if so desired. That's over $500 for the total package.

| | Cadillac Owners Member | | | | | Re: SRX Trailer Hitch The towing weight is not dependent on the powertrain, it is dependent on the cooling package. 1000 lb for the base cooling package (electric cooling fan) and 3500 lb with the heavy duty cooling package (the cooling fan is mounted on the engine). This is true for both V6 and V8. |

Hemi AWD | | Join Date: Mar 2004 Location: South Bend, IN Age: 63 | | | Re: SRX Trailer Hitch If you gave them the right #, it all comes in 1 box. I includes hitch, all bolts & nuts, receiver bar, and all wireing. Even the install instructions. You only need the appropriate ball.
I did it myself---with a little help. I did have a set of ramps, which I backed up onto, which were indespensible! About 1 1/2 hours, but could do another in 1/2 that time.
Dealer cost WAS (in April) $250, and list about $358. My dealer let me have it for cost + 10%.
